Wind Power Generator Market Innovation and Development Trends 2026-2035 Wind Power Generator Market Size • The Wind Power Generator Market was valued at USD 28640 million in 2025, as reported by Saturate Insights. • It is projected to reach USD 64280 million by 2035, expanding at a CAGR of 8.4% over the forecast period. The Wind Power Generator Market is experiencing steady expansion due to the increasing global emphasis on renewable energy generation, carbon emission reduction, and energy security. Governments across developed and emerging economies are implementing favorable policies, financial incentives, and renewable energy targets that encourage large-scale wind power installations. Technological advancements in generator efficiency, lightweight materials, digital monitoring systems, and offshore wind infrastructure are further supporting market growth. Rising investments in utility-scale wind farms, repowering of aging turbines, and the integration of smart grid technologies continue to strengthen the industry's long-term outlook. Wind Power Generator Market Channel Distribution Analysis The wind power generator market is primarily driven through direct sales channels involving turbine manufacturers, engineering procurement and construction (EPC) contractors, independent power producers, and utility companies. Large-scale renewable energy projects generally procure generators directly from manufacturers through long-term contracts. Strategic partnerships, government-backed tenders, and project-based procurement dominate the distribution landscape. Service providers offering installation, maintenance, and aftermarket support also play a critical role in strengthening customer relationships and ensuring long-term operational performance of wind power projects. Which installation segment dominates the Wind Power Generator Market? The onshore segment currently accounts for the largest market share due to lower installation costs, while offshore installations are expected to witness the fastest growth. Q3. Which region is expected to grow the fastest during the forecast period? Asia-Pacific is projected to register the highest growth owing to significant wind energy capacity additions, strong manufacturing capabilities, and supportive renewable energy policies. Q4.
